Stephanie L. Royal is the Founder and Managing Attorney of the Royal Legal Group, PLLC, which also operates as the Royal Law Office and Royal Dispute Resolution Services. With 25 years of experience practicing law for government entities in Pennsylvania, the District of Columbia, and Maryland, Stephanie decided to open her own law practice after being motivated by divine inspiration.
As a seasoned attorney and former judicial law clerk, Stephanie has a wealth of experience. She has a strong track record of saving consumers money by settling debts and addressing unscrupulous business practices. Her practice areas include consumer protection, business matters, estate planning, probate administration, and probate litigation. Stephanie is known for her problem-solving abilities and employs various approaches to achieve results, such as meetings, negotiations, legal correspondence, and, as a last resort, civil litigation.
Throughout her career, Stephanie has been dedicated to helping people and serving her community. As a teenager, she volunteered at a hospital in Pittsburgh, PA. During her time as a Deputy Attorney General in the Consumer Protection Section of the Pennsylvania Attorney General's Office, she provided consumer education to various groups, including senior citizens, students, and civic associations, empowering them with knowledge about their consumer rights. Her mantra from her Consumer Protection Days is "if it sounds too good to be true, it probably is." Stephanie has actively served her community in multiple roles, including as a board member of Neighborhood Legal Services in Pittsburgh, PA, a volunteer mediator for the Conflict Resolution Center of Montgomery County, MD, and the Rockville Office of Human Rights, and a volunteer boys' basketball coach for Montgomery County, Maryland, for five years. She is also involved in her church and has musical talents, playing the flute and piano.
In her current legal practice, based in the District of Columbia and Maryland, Stephanie specializes in Consumer and Business Matters, Estate Planning, and Probate Administration. She also handles litigation in areas such as Consumer Protection, Breach of Contract, Debt Collection Defense, and Probate matters.
